Zambia - Export of Live Fish
Since 2014, Zambia Export of Live Fish decreased by 10.5% year on year. In 2019, the country was ranked number 59 comparing other countries in Export of Live Fish with $149,393.59. Zambia is overtaken by Belarus, which was number 58 with $154,619 and is followed by Romania at $143,060.67. China lead the ranking with $287,621,794.21 in 2019, -0.7% versus 2018. South Korea, France and Japan resp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Ghana witnessed the best average annual growth at +218.3% per year, while Burundi recorded the worst performance at -63.9% per year.
